Kyzyltash Fm
Type Locality and Naming
Along the Kyzyltash section, South-Western Gissar. N.P. Kheraskov, 1934 (487, p.19). Stratotype, probably in the Kyzyltash section. Upper formation in the Takchiyan Gr. Included in the Kyzyltash Horizon (55; 115; 133; 167; 274; 362; 363; 383; 415; 445; 498).
Synonym: Kyzyltash Formation, Кызылтатская св.
Lithology and Thickness
Reddish-brown clays, sandstones, siltstone (aleurolites) with layers of bluish-gray sandstones. In Central Gissar, sandstones, gravelites with rare layers of siltstone (aleurolites). Thickness 50-130m.
Relationships and Distribution
Lower contact
Lies conformably on the Almurad Fm, with erosion on the Shirkent Fm
Upper contact
Conformably overlain by the Okuzbulak Gr.
Regional extent
South-Western, Southern, Central Gissar, Babatag ridge. Buhara-Karshinsky district borehole.

Fossils
Contains freshwater bivalve mollusks - Trigonioides kodairaiformis Mart., Limnocyrena gissarica Mart.; ostracods - Malzevia ex gr. pellucida (And.), M. malzi Andrv., spores and pollen.
